The Pasco County School District and the employees union reached a tentative contract agreement this evening that would keep salaries the same as they were in 2007-2008. There would be no raises or step increases although employees would still be given a year of credit for their service. The contract for teachers and other school workers must be ratified by employees and approved by the school board. That process is expected to take place in January. ...more
